I thought we all were in agreement that surface area is a crucial parameter when you take into consideration weight force (riders weight) and the lift equation on the same foil?

The same foil is not the same for all riders and the foil should be scaled to cater for the different weight ranges of people.

Unfortunately I don't understand French, is there an English transcript? I assume he is explaining in layman's terms all the parameters involved in the mathematical equations that determines lift, which were mentioned a few pages back.

Postby Frankieboy » Fri Aug 20, 2021 8:20 am

addictedtofoil wrote:
Thu Aug 19, 2021 9:48 pm
Unfortunately I don't understand French, is there an English transcript?
Basically he says how a foil works but for what we discuss here he says:

- he is >100kg
- surface is only one of the parameter
- thicker profiles induce more lift, profile also has an influence but he won't go into this details
- the more HA the more lift, he compares a smaller HA to a bigger LA and says he gets going quicker on the HA (both quite thick profiles) - about 4 knots of speed for him
- the bigger the surface, the more drag you have

So for me same lift is possible between smaller HA and bigger LA (assuming same thickness and profile) but you get more speed (less drag)
The data we getfrom SAB is only surface and thickness, nothing about profile. So it says nothing IMO.
